Hello plugin authors,

Next Thursday, Corbexa will run a disaster-recovery drill for the RestockRoute vending-machine restock planner. During the failover window, plugin callbacks will be replayed against the standby scheduler, so please ensure your handlers are idempotent and tolerate duplicate route assignments. No customer restock data will be altered. To re-register your plugin against the standby environment during the drill, authenticate with the recovery passphrase provided below.

vault phrase of hahip-tajeg = quenax-briath-briax

## Idempotency Keys for Payment Retries (Lumopay)

Every retry of a charge request must reuse the original idempotency key; generating a new key on retry can produce duplicate charges. Keys are scoped per merchant and expire after 48 hours. Reviewers should verify keys are derived server-side, never from client input. The full key-generation specification and threat model are maintained on the internal page.

dashboard of kaguf-tawip = https://vault.merlaqsys.test/issue

Ticket: DEDUP-412 — Connection failures during customer record dedup

The Larkspur dedup job started failing overnight with pool exhaustion errors. It merges duplicate customer records in batches of 500, but the batch worker isn't releasing connections after a merge conflict, so the pool drains within twenty minutes. Proposed fix: wrap merges in a try/finally release and cap retries at three. For the sync, reproduce against staging using the connection string below.

primary connection of bagep-kaweg = clickhouse://rusdor_svc:3TXlgH7O8DuUYI@db-ae3f.zarqelgrid.internal:5432/zordor

Finance Review Summary — Korrin Instruments

Subject: Retirement of the Falcrest gauge line.

Falcrest revenue down 31% YoY. Support costs exceed gross margin as of Q2. Recommendation: halt production end of Q4, honor warranties through existing reserves. Inventory write-down estimated at mid six figures, already provisioned. No headcount impact; staff reassigned to the Marwick line. Board sign-off expected next cycle. Strategic context follows for restricted readers only.

internal memo for kawip-hadug: Headcount on the Wenwyn team goes from 7 to 140 by the end of January. Gross margin on Wenwyn came in at 20 percent against a plan of 15 percent.